Abstract
An atomization cup including a cup body. The cup body includes a cavity and at least one through hole. The cavity is configured to accommodate a tobacco material. The smoke or vapor generated by the tobacco material escapes from the cup body via the at least one through hole. The at least one through hole communicates with the cavity. The cup body further includes a side wall. The side wall includes a heating element made of conductive material, or the side wall is made of conductive material.

[0062] The cup body 10 comprises a side wall 14 comprising an inner surface and an outer surface. A heating element 16 is disposed inside the side wall 14. Alternatively, the heating element 16 is disposed on the outer surface of the side wall 14. Alternatively, the heating element 16 is disposed inside the side wall 14 and disposed on the outer surface of the side wall 14. Or, the heating element 16 is disposed in the inner layer of the side wall, or the side wall 14 is made of conductive material.
[0063] The tobacco materials (such as tobacco tar, tobacco paste, etc.) are placed into the cavity 11 through the opening 12, or the heated tobacco materials are taken out from the cavity 11 through the opening 12. The smoke generated escapes from the cup body 1 via the through hole 13 and is inhaled through the user's mouth.
